Output 8edaceff6fef5d4b2d5c03357f02ec49b25a7b383c564e5a0c4a0648d896e843:3

value
44065516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5934e2027fdef581ed86b76215d917e9d49ea3d OP_EQUAL
address
3MAJKM52q8DsaEEeRSe4hoQmB9XyiKAEwB
transaction
8edaceff6fef5d4b2d5c03357f02ec49b25a7b383c564e5a0c4a0648d896e843
spent
true